The volume of a gas is a function of both pressure and temperature. At STP, 1 mol of gas occupies 22.4 liters (L) of volume. In other words, the molar volume of a gas at STP is 22.4 L. This volume can be found using the ideal gas law: PV=nRT (n = number of moles, R = ...

Mercury is the densest liquid at standard conditions for temperature and pressure (STP). Also called quicksilver, mercury has been known for more than 3,500 years. It is an important metal in industry, but it is also toxic. The Densest Liquid ...
